Raspberry Mousse
A raspberry mousse made with red wine, sour cream and whipped cream, set in the refrigerator.
⏱️ Prep: 20 min🍳 Cook: 20 min
Ingredients
| 400 g | raspberries (fresh or frozen) |
| 300 g | sour cream |
| 200 ml | liquid cream, unsweetened |
| 100 ml | red wine |
| 100 g | powdered sugar |
| 2 sachets | gelatin |
Instructions
Prep 20 min · Cook 20 min · Total 40 min · Serves 7-8
- Sprinkle the raspberries with the sugar and, together with the wine, place them in a pot on the stove to boil. Once they have boiled and softened, remove and puree.
- Strain the mixture through a metal sieve and dissolve the pre-soaked gelatin into the still-hot syrup. Stir until dissolved and place in a bowl of iced water to cool, stirring again.
- Into the cooled raspberry mixture, stir the sour cream until the cream is homogenized.
- Finally add the whipped liquid cream.
- Pour the prepared raspberry mousse into dessert cups or bowls and place in the refrigerator for a few hours to set.
